Dungeness National Nature Reserve

Dungeness is unique ? no boundaries, a desolate landscape with wooden houses, power stations, lighthouses and expansive gravel pits. Yet it possesses a rich and diverse wildlife within the National Nature Reserve in one of the largest shingle landscapes in the world. Lakes Aquarium

The Lakes Aquarium is an aquarium in the village of Lakeside on the southern shore of Windermere, Cumbria, England. It is one of the docking points of Windermere Lake Cruises and also at one end of the Lakeside and Haverthwaite Railway. It is the third most visited paying tourist attraction in Cumbria . Rode Hall & Gardens

Rode Hall, a Georgian country house, is the seat of the Wilbraham family, members of the landed gentry in the parish of Odd Rode, Cheshire, England. RSPB Northward Hill

You’ll find Northward Hill on a ridge overlooking the Thames Marshes and its resident marsh harriers. It’s a working farm with cows and sheep, surrounded by scrubland that’s rich in nightingales and whitethroats. There’s also a lovely bluebell wood, a large rookery and a cherry orchard to discover.

Richmond Park

Richmond Park, in the London Borough of Richmond upon Thames, was created by Charles I in the 17th century as a deer park. The largest of London’s Royal Parks, it is of national and international importance for wildlife conservation. RSPB Havergate Island

This small island in the River Ore is famous for its avocets, terns and spoonbills. In autumn and winter, the island provides a haven for large numbers of ducks and wading birds. Havergate is also a great place to see brown hares at close range.

The Wash National Nature Reserve

The reserve is a mix of open deep water, permanent shallow water, mudflats and saltmarsh, representing one of Britain?s most important winter feeding areas for waders and wildfowl.
